The Megger SMRT36 has the "smart" combination of high compliance voltage and high current to test all electromechanical, solid-state and microprocessor-based overcurrent relays, including voltage controlled, voltage restraint and directional overcurrent.

The SMRT36 with three VIGEN Modules provides a complete three-phase test system for commissioning of three phase protection systems. With the voltage channels converted to currents, the same unit can provide 6-phase current. The SMRT36 VIGEN modules also provide high power in BOTH the voltage and current channels to test virtually all types of protective relays.

The SMRT36 test system has the ability to be manually controlled with Megger's new Smart Touch View Interface™ (STVI). The STVI, with its large, full color, high resolution, TFT LCD touch screen allows the user to perform manual, steady-state and dynamic testing quickly and easily using the manual test screen, as well as using built-in preset test routines for most popular relays.

Features

  • Small, rugged, lightweight and powerful
  • Operate with or without a computer
  • Intuitive manual operation with Smart Touch View Interface
  • High current, high power output (60 Amps/300 VA rms) per phase
  • Convertible channels provides 6 currents
  • Network interface provides IEC 61850 test capabilities
  • Fully automated testing using AVTS Software

AC Voltge Amplitude

  • Accuracy: ±0.05 % reading + 0.02 % range typical, ±0.15 % reading + 0.05 % range maximum
  • Resolution: .01
  • Measurements: AC RMS
  • Ranges: 30, 150, 300V

AC Current Amplitude

  • Accuracy: ±0.05 % reading + 0.02 % range typical, ±0.15 % reading + 0.05 % range maximum
  • Resolution: .001/.01
  • Measurements: AC RMS
    Ranges: 30, 60A

DC Voltage Amplitude

  • Accuracy: 0.1% range typical, 0.25% range maximum
  • Resolution: .01
  • Measurements: RMS
  • Ranges: 30, 150, 300V

DC Current Amplitude

  • Accuracy: ±0.05 % reading + 0.02 % range typical, ±0.15 % reading + 0.05 % range maximum
  • Resolution: .001/.01
  • Measurements: RMS
  • Ranges: 30A

Convertible Source in AC Current Mode

  • Accuracy: ±0.05 % reading + 0.02 % range typical, ±0.15 % reading + 0.05 % range or ±12.5 mA whichever is greater
  • Resolution: .001
  • Measurements: AC RMS
  • Range: 5, 15A

Environmental

  • Operating Temperature: 32 to 122° F (0 to 50° C)
  • Storage Temperature: -13 to 158° F (-25 to 70° C)
  • Relative Humidity: 5 - 90% RH, Non-condensing

Dimensions

  • With the lid on: 14.2 W x 7.6 H x 12.0 D in; (360 W x 194 H x 305 D mm)
  • With the lid off: 14.2 W x 7.2 H x 12.0 D in; (360 W x 180 H x 305 D mm)

Weight

  • With the transit lid on: 27.9 lbs (12.55 kg)
  • With the transit lid off: 25.8 lbs (11.6 kg)
